Frequently Asked Questions
How does MeldAmp handle privacy?
MeldAmp is designed to be a privacy-first music player. It collects basic analytics usage data such as features used, launch times, playlist length, and other basic metrics such as operating system and version to help us improve the app and understand how it is being used. See privacy policy for more detail.
Does MeldAmp play cloud-based music?
MeldAmp does not play online or cloud-based music. It plays offline music files that are saved to your desktop. See list of supported audio formats.
What technology stack was used to build MeldAmp?
MeldAmp was built using using Electron. See the Technical Stack page for more detail.
